As per the description you have shared, we understand that you have a concern with To-Do Tasks functionality.
Since you mentioned that, you are currently using Outlook Tasks and forced to open tasks in To Do, may I please confirm if "Open tasks in the To Do app" option is enabled in your Outlook? if you haven't check it yet, please kindly open your Outlook --> Go to File -->Options -->Tasks -->Uncheck Open tasks in the To Do app option -->OK. In addition, please kindly Go to File -->Options -->Advanced -->uncheck Show Apps in Outlook -->OK. Then, restart your Outlook and check if there is any difference.
